我目前正在做一個自定義屬性,併爲我的一個ASP.NET MVC項目做了一些自定義類。ASP.NET MVC:自定義類,屬性等的正確位置
我想知道,有沒有一個專門的位置來放置它們?我的意思是,一些正確的路徑命名或其他。
像控制器進去控制器\,在模型的模型\,等...
任何建議,歡迎!
謝謝!
我目前正在做一個自定義屬性,併爲我的一個ASP.NET MVC項目做了一些自定義類。ASP.NET MVC:自定義類,屬性等的正確位置
我想知道,有沒有一個專門的位置來放置它們?我的意思是,一些正確的路徑命名或其他。
像控制器進去控制器\,在模型的模型\,等...
任何建議,歡迎!
謝謝!
如果這些屬性代表自定義操作篩選器,我會將它們放入Filters
sibfolder。如果它們代表驗證器數據註釋,則進入Validators
文件夾,...因此,根據它們的功能,我會找到一個名稱。
我通常的做法是添加一個單獨的庫項目,並將它們放在那裏,在那裏的描述性文件夾下,將「MVC」從「其餘」分開。根據當然項目的規模,我會按照以前的答案來做小型項目,並用描述性名稱創建新文件夾。
像這樣的東西應該能夠去任何你覺得合適的地方,最常見的是,我最終看到了類似於Common或Infrastructure文件夾下的相關類。 – 2011-05-27 13:10:04